Abstract

Clinical handover is the transfer of professional responsibility and accountability for some or all aspects of care for a patient or group of patients to another person/family / legal guardian or professional group on a temporary or permanent basis. It is one of the most important skills that health professionals and students need to be taught. There are several structured formats available for clinical handover. e.g. IPASS3. I-SBAR is a mnemonic that aids in safe handover of patient information and improves communication and decision-making. This technique improves the efficiency and accuracy of Handing and Taking over the process by staff nurses4. PROBLEM STATEMENT: "A study to assess the knowledge regarding I-SBAR handing and taking over tool among staff nurses working in selected city hospitals." OBJECTIVES OF STUDY: • To assess the knowledge among staff nurses regarding the I-SBAR handing and taking over tool • To find an association of knowledge regarding the I-SBAR handing and to take over the tool with selected demographic variables. METHODS: The study was conducted at MGM of Chh. sambhajinagar city. The present study's sample size was 80 MGM hospital Chh staff nurses. sambhajinagar. A structured questionnaire regarding the ISBAR handing and taking over tool was used to assess the knowledge of staff nurses in MGM Hospital Chh. Sambhajinagar. 9 RESULTS:. The majority of samples, 57 (71.25%), have good knowledge regarding ISBAR handing and taking over the tools, 19 (23.75%) samples have average knowledge regarding ISBAR handing and taking over the tools, and 4 (5%) samples have poor knowledge regarding ISBAR handing and taking over a tool. CONCLUSION: This study assessed the knowledge regarding ISBAR handling and taking over tools. Based on the result, the investigator concluded that there was a significant association between religion and the knowledge of staff nurses regarding ISBAR handing and taking over tools.
